Your Job Georgia-Pacific is seeking a proactive and analytical Senior Supply Chain Analyst to join our GP Corrugated End-to-End Supply Chain Team. This role is critical in supporting and optimizing downstream supply chain operations in the rapidly growing corrugated business sector. The role will provide support to our East Region facilities, which includes seven Corrugated plants and ten off-site warehouses (both GP and 3PL managed). Check out these videos/links to learn more about the Corrugated Business at Georgia-Pacific: Georgia-Pacific: About Us What You Will Do This position will support the downstream portion of the corrugated supply chain which includes, but is not limited to shipping, transportation, and warehousing. This individual must have the ability to partner with numerous cross-functional teams simultaneously. They must be able to drive change, root cause deviations from standard processes, motivate, and hold accountable groups and individuals that do not directly report to them. They should be capable of ensuring alignment across all resources within the business to implement supply chain strategies and processes, while also developing, maintaining, and achieving KPI targets. This role provides data analysis, uses economic thinking, and offers recommendations to optimize our warehouse networks and partners, reduce supply chain costs, and drive profitably in this emerging and rapidly expanding business. This needs to be done while simultaneously supporting internal and external customers and providing best-in-class customer service. Who We Are As a Koch company and a leading manufacturer of bath tissue, paper towels, paper-based packaging, cellulose, specialty fibers, building products and much more, Georgia-Pacific works to meet evolving needs of customers worldwide with quality products. In addition to the products we make, we operate one of the largest recycling businesses. Our more than 30,000 employees in over 150 locations are empowered to innovate every day - to make everyday products even better.
